Yeehaw! Last month Tucson students enjoyed two days off from school for Rodeo Break. This tradition began in 1925 when the entire city shut down for the first Tucson rodeo. Since every child in town was in the rodeo parade or planning to attend it, schools did not bother to stay open.

Did you know our zoo is having a birthday soon? I spoke with Chelo Grubb with the Reid Park Zoo about the 60th anniversary plans. She told me that Reid Park Zoo was started in 1965 by Gene C. Reid. It started with just a few animals such as pheasants, peacocks and other birds. A few years later it grew into a Prairie Dog town and over time it grew into the Zoo that we know today. Gene C. Reid was Tucson's Parks and Recreations director in the 1960s.

In the summer of 2024, I spent seven weeks in the BIO 5 Institutes KEYS (Keep Engaging Youth in Science) high school internship. The training program aims to foster a close-knit community of students while allowing them to explore their diverse interests in STEM research. Although the process of writing, submitting assignments, and approval was difficult, I knew every day of KEYS inspired me with new knowledge and tasks that would help me to grow for my college and future career.
